摘要
目的:比较血管外渗探测技术在不同注射速率和不同穿刺部位下监测对比剂外渗的报警率结果,探讨该技术的临床应用价值。方法:收集接受CT增强扫描的5572例患者资料,将其分为常规增强扫描组和CTA成像组,注射速率分别为2~3 ml/s、4~6 ml/s,所有患者均使用血管外渗探测贴片,每组内穿刺针穿刺部位分为肘正中静脉处及腕关节头静脉起始处,血管外渗探测片平铺或卷铺于皮肤表面。比较不同组别血管外渗探测贴片对对比剂外渗监测报警率。结果:常规增强组中探测贴片平铺1165例,对比剂外渗报警3例;卷铺1921例,报警0例,差异有统计学(x2=4.952,P<0.05);CTA组中探测贴片平铺1426例,对比剂外渗报警6例;卷铺1060例,报警0例,差异有统计学意义(x2=4.471;P<0.05)。探测贴片平铺时对对比剂外渗的监测效果明显优于卷铺。结论:血管外渗探测贴片可监测对比剂外渗的发生,合理、正确使用,有助于降低对比剂外渗发生率,减少对比剂外渗量。
Objective:To compare the alarm rates of contrast agent extravasation at different injection rate of contrast agent in different puncture site using extravasation detection technology ,discuss its clinical application value.Methods: About 5572 cases were underwent CT enhancement scanning from 2012.2-2012.10. All cases were divided into two groups according to the different rate of contrast agent injection: the first group is routine enhanced scanning group, the injection rate of the first group is 2-3ml/s, second group is CTA ,the injection rates is 4-6ml/s, all patients with vascular extravasation detection technology. The foregone groups were divided into two groups according to the different puncture site: the first group of the puncture site at cubital vein, vascular extravasation detection can be tiled on skin; second groups was located in the head start of wrist vein, extravasation detection sheet rolling and spreading on skin. Comparison of different groups of extravasation detection chip alarm rates for contrast agent extravasation monitoring.Results: In the contrast agent injection rate 2-3ml/s group, extravasation detection patch tiled in 1165 cases extravasation contrast alarmed in 3 cases, rolling and spreading in 1921 cases, alarmed in 0 cases, there was a significant difference in statistical analysis showed that among the two (x2=4.952,P<0.05) in the 4-6ml/s group, extravasation detection patch tiled in 1426 cases, 6 cases alarmed, 1060 cases of rolling and spreading, extravasation of contrast and alarm in 0 cases, there was a significant difference in statistical analysis indicated that two (x2=4.471,P<0.05). The detection effect of vascular extravasation detection patch was significantly better in tiling group.Conclusion: On the basic of reasonably and correctly applicate, extravasation detection patch can effectively monitor the contrast agent extravasation occurred, reduce the incidence of extravasation of contrast, decreased the amount of contrast medium extravasation.
